Literature Reference: 叶上曾槐变,花发小堂春。—— 《和左仆射燕公春日端居述怀》 Leaves once turned to locusts, flowers bloom in the small hall of spring. Source from 'He Zuo Puye Yan Gong Chunri Duanju Shuhuai'.
小: The original meaning: fine, subtle. In contrast to "large."
堂: The main hall, the distinguished guest. In names, it often refers to someone handsome and dashing.
Meaning: Small hall implies a cozy and harmonious dwelling, symbolizing tranquility, warmth, and balance.
